About this Event

Houston, a global economic hub, thrives on international investment and trade. Boasting a strategic location and diverse industries, the city attracts foreign investors, fostering economic growth. A strong port system and our international airports offer vital gateways and facilitate seamless trade, positioning the city as a key player in the international business landscape. 

Hear from: 

  • Joe Barnes, Bonner Means Baker Fellow at the Baker Institute, Rice University
